The formula for determining the area of a rectangle is expressed as
Area = length × width
Their backyard is rectangular, with a length of 3x – 5 feet and a width of 4x – 10 feet. This means that the area of the backyard is
(3x - 5)(4x - 10)
= 12x² - 30x - 20x + 15
= (12x² - 50x + 15) square feet
Their rectangular swimming pool, along with its surrounding patio, has dimensions of x + 8 by x – 2 feet. This means that the area occupied by the swimming pool and its surrounding patio is
(x + 8)(x - 2)
= x² - 2x + 8x - 16
= x² + 6x - 16
Assuming the swimming pool and its surrounding patio will not be covered with new grass, then the area of the region of the yard that they want to cover with new grass is
12x² - 50x + 15 - (x² + 6x - 16)
= 12x² - 50x + 15 - x² - 6x + 16
= 12x² - x² - 50x - 6x + 15 + 16
= 11x² - 56x + 31 square feet

Answer: $0.60 per wing
Explanation:
We’ll solve this with a set of equations since the price per wing is fixed and they paid the sam amount at the restaurant. Let x represent the cost of 1 wing.
8x + 4.00 = 10x + 2.80
4.00 = 2x + 2.80
1.20 = 2x
0.60 = x
So, we have found that one wing cost $0.60.
